I purchased this Black S1 R33 GTS-T soon after I destroyed 'S1KR33'.
Realistically, the demise of S1KR33 was probably the best outcome possible. It was never really as clean & tidy as I wanted, and would have needed too much $ to get it where I wanted it! (Full respray, re-wiring etc)
So the new Black '33 has been around since about Sept '08, and with tastful mods & nothing crazy (it's a daily), I'm pretty happy with it!
Performance
All the basics really... Apexi air filter, a small Apexi intercooler (utilises standard piping, which I prefer because I get less attention from cops without the shiny chrome bits!), cat back exhaust, Gizmo 4 stage boost controller, and a heavy duty clutch. I'm pretty sure a previous owner must have had the computer fiddled with too, because it runs completely different (better) than my old one! (no speed limiter either)
